Classic bags: Fendi baguette

The Fendi baguette is often cited as launching the "It-bag" trend in the US back in 1997 when Carrie Bradshaw on Sex and the City declared it her signature bag. The small bag features the double F logo famously created by Karl Lagerfeld when he began working for the luxury leather company in 1962. Silvia Venturini Fendi actually designed the Baguette, it fits just under your arm and is carried like french bread, hence the name. She took inspiration from vintage bags, which explains the smaller size. It is now available in many different fabrics, from leather to crocodile to embroided straw.
